About The Position

The Vermont Army Reserve National Guard (VTARNG) Office of the Deputy State Surgeon has a requirement to provide Non Clinical Case Management Services for VTARNG service members (SM) thereby promoting fitness and personal wellness for operational readiness and deployability. Non-Clinical case Managers coordinate all aspects of the care of individual patients. They ensure proper utilization of services and resources and provide assistance within, between, and outside of VTARNG facilities.

Responsibilities

  • Support Periodic Health Assessments and Soldier Readiness Processing events by providing case management services and coordinating care activities.
  • Establish and maintain electronic case management profiles within required timelines following provider referral.
  • Prepare and contribute to monthly case status reports by tracking Soldier care progression and readiness outcomes.
  • Apply Individual Medical Readiness and deployment regulations while obtaining required medical release documentation.
  • Maintain compliance with Health Insurance Portability and Accountability Act standards during all case management activities.
  • Document medical and administrative information across required systems, ensuring accuracy and completion within established timelines.
  • Prepare and review case files for Medical Evaluation Board and Physical Evaluation Board processes, ensuring completeness and accuracy.
  • Communicate with Government personnel to track compliance and address case management requirements.
  • Engage with Soldiers to explain requirements, obtain documentation, and ensure understanding of responsibilities and privacy rights.
  • Manage medical profiles and contribute to reporting on profile status and updates.
  • Identify and coordinate submission of medical documents in accordance with required processing timelines.
  • Participate in monthly case reviews, presenting case information and supporting follow-up actions
